How to Separate Strong Magnets - K&J Magnetics

Small magnets can be separated by hand, usually without any mechanical aid. Magnets with listed Pull Force Case 1 values of about 5 lb or less fall into this category. The key is to slide one magnet off the stack with a lateral motion, as shown in the video of D42 magnets below. The video for our B333 cubes is also instructive.

Magnetic particle separation : a short review - Elveflow

A magnetically tagged object submitted to a drag force inside a microfluidic channel is also submitted to a magnetic force when passing near soft magnetic stripes. The angle between the magnetic and the drag force deviates the object from its initial path, thus, separation can be achieved.

magnetic force | Definition, Formula, Examples, & Facts ...

Magnetic force, attraction or repulsion that arises between electrically charged particles because of their motion. It is the basic force responsible for such effects as the action of electric motors and the attraction of magnets for iron. Electric forces exist among stationary electric charges;

Magnetism - Repulsion or attraction between two magnetic ...

Repulsion or attraction between two magnetic dipoles. The force between two wires, each of which carries a current, can be understood from the interaction of one of the currents with the magnetic field produced by the other current. For example, the force between two parallel wires carrying currents in the same direction is attractive. It is repulsive if the currents are in opposite directions.

Separation Techniques | Classification of Matter

Magnetic Separation Magnetic separation is a process in which magnetically susceptible material is extracted from a mixture using a magnetic force. This separation technique can be useful in mining iron as it is attracted to a magnet. Magnetism is ideal for separating mixtures of two solids with one part having magnetic properties.
